University of Arkansas / Fayetteville
- Established in 1871
- The University of Arkansas campus includes 276 buildings on 357 acres.
- The University offers more than 200 undergraduate and graduate degrees in more than 150 fields of study in agricultural, food and life sciences, arts and sciences, business, education, engineering, architecture, and law.
- Old Main, one of the oldest buildings in the state, is widely known as "the symbol of higher education in Arkansas." Old Main houses the Fulbright College of Arts and Sciences, its honors program, and five academic departments.
- Senior Walk is the University's longest tradition -- not in years, but in miles. Starting with the first class of 1876, every graduate's name is etched into a concrete sidewalk that winds its way around campus for nearly three miles. More than 124,000 graduates are listed on Senior Walk.
